ABRASIVE BLASTING. IPS' abrasive blasting process is an internal cleaning method that injects hard cleaning particles into a gaseous medium. These cleaning particles impact the internal surface of the pipe wall, removing oxides and hard scale deposits, leaving a minimum NACE 1 finish.

Dolomite crushing process usually undergoes two times of crushing, the specific process steps are as follows: 1. Initial crushing: After blasting and mining, large dolomite materials are evenly sent to jaw crusher by vibration feeder for initial crushing processing, then reasonably screened by circular vibration screen, and unqualified stones are sent back to jaw crusher for recrushing.
The topsoil is removed and the ore is loosened by drilling and blasting. Haulage trucks move the ore to stockpiles. From there a conveyor belt system transports the ore to the crushers at the processing plant. The ore undergoes a series of crushing steps to reduce the particle size.

Abrasive blasting operations can create high levels of dust and noise. Abrasive material and the surface being blasted may contain toxic materials (, lead paint, silica) that are hazardous to workers. • Silica sand (crystalline) can cause silicosis, lung cancer, and breathing problems in exposed workers.

Iron Mining Process. From blasting to crushing to separation – more than 85% of the iron mined in the United States is mined in northeastern Minnesota to make our nation's steel. Blasting Taconite is a very hard rock. Using explosives, the taconite is blasted into small pieces.
